存储架构,nas小型机,超融合

对于家用电脑或者笔记本而言,通常只有一个硬盘,与主机系统直连。但对于实际公司的生产而言,通常有多台电脑,多台服务器,并且要存储大量的数据,这些数据还不能丢失,需要传输共享到其它存储盘上,那就需要用到存储架构。

问题一:如何存储10T的数据?

通常一台电脑的硬盘容量在1T左右,但如果超过了这个数,除了上云,还可以外接一个硬盘。如果外接一块硬盘还不够,那可以接多个,例如这是一个希捷的nas小型机:

它可以通过网线直连笔记本电脑,带4个2T的机械硬盘,总容量来到了8T。除了通过网线直连,还可以连接同一个wifi,确保在同一个网段内之后,即可在电脑浏览器上输入nas小型机的ip地址来访问。除了储存数据,nas小型机还有以下一些功能:

  1. 家庭共享(都在一个局域网下,类似于生产环境不同服务器之间数据访问);
  2. 私人网盘,外网访问;
  3. 家庭影音媒体服务器;
  4. 远程下载;
  5. 虚拟机。

专做nas网络存储服务器的厂商:群晖,机械硬盘三大厂:希捷、东芝、西部数据;

注:磁盘有一定的损坏率,第一年1%,但到了五年,十年,顺坏率可能就到5%~10%。因此,要确保数据不丢失,可以看RAID这篇文章(A Case for Redundant Arrays of Inexpensive Disks)

问题二:如何存储100T的数据?

如果要收集一些深度学习训练模型的原始数据,那么通常数据量在几十到几百TB不等;中小企业的产生的数据量也大概是这个水平。还是可以通过大容量硬盘的nas小型机来实现:

SSD作为缓存,HDD(8×16TB)作为数据存储。

问题三:如何存储500T以上的数据?

这就要用到存储服务器了:例如dell的2U存储服务器,能放26块硬盘;

服务器行业,1U1.75英寸(约为4.45厘米),2U3.5英寸(约为8.9厘米),4U7英寸(约为17.8厘米)。

硬盘厂家按1000来计数,电脑是按1024,因此实际可用会打一个9折,16T->14.6T。

问题四:超融合?网络+存储+交换机?

HCI——Hyper Converged Infrastructure,用一台服务器承载计算、网络、虚拟、存储所有功能。

一个最小的超融合单元,都是三个节点起,分布式存储都是通过软件定义,采用投票算法来保证数据冗余和最终一致性;要求半数以上节点获得大多数支持时才可以更新数据;整机的读写性能上线被限制在单块硬盘的读写速度上;为了提高单机的IOPS,超融合引入了:缓存机制,利用固态硬盘来为机械硬盘提供缓存;数据先读取到缓存盘,再由缓存盘将数据写入机械硬盘区;徐还需要万兆网卡;万兆交换机,把三台服务器连接起来。软件定义数据中心,因此还需要依赖虚拟化平台,需要额外准备硬盘用于安装虚拟化平台软件。

搭建超融合的存储架构,需:

### 超融合技术概述 超融合是一种现代数据中心架构,它将计算、存储、网络和其他虚拟化组件集成到单个系统中[^1]。这种架构旨在简化基础设施管理并提高资源利用率。通过软件定义的方式实现硬件抽象化,使得管理员可以更加便捷地管理和扩展其IT环境。 #### 技术原理 超融合的核心理念在于利用标准化服务器构建分布式集群来替代传统独立运作的SAN/NAS设备。每台节点不仅承担着运行应用程序的工作负载还负责本地数据副本维护以及参与全局文件系统或者对象存储服务的任务[^3]。具体来说: - **统一管理平面**:所有资源都可通过单一界面进行配置和监控; - **弹性伸缩性**:新增物理机加入现有群集即可自动分配任务无需额外规划容量分布; - **内置高可用机制**:即使部分成员失效也能保障业务连续性和数据完整性; 以下是基于Python的一个简易模拟程序展示如何创建一个小型化的HCI框架雏形: ```python class Node: def __init__(self, id_, cpu=8, memory=32): self.id_ = id_ self.cpu = cpu self.memory = memory def info(self): return f'Node {self.id_}: CPU-{self.cpu}, Memory-{self.memory}GB' nodes = [] for i in range(3): nodes.append(Node(i)) def cluster_status(): status = "" for node in nodes: status += "\n" + node.info() return "Cluster Status:" + status print(cluster_status()) ``` 此脚本仅用于教学目的演示基本概念,并未涉及实际生产环境中所需的众多细节考虑因素如冗余设计、性能优化等方面的内容。 #### 应用场景分析 在实际的企业级部署当中,采用超融合解决方案可以帮助组织显著降低总体拥有成本(TCO),同时加快新项目上线速度约达一半以上的时间消耗[^4]。除此之外,在面对日益增长的数据量及其多样化访问模式时——比如实时交易记录更新的同时还需要支持复杂的商业智能报表生成请求等情况之下,则特别适合运用具备全场景覆盖能力特性的超融合型数据库产品来进行支撑处理作业流程效率最大化目标达成[^2]。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值